This illustrated biography offers an intimate look into Coco Chanel’s life through new research and interviews with her family. Expert Isabelle Fiemeyer delves into Chanel’s personal world, exploring her love for symbolism, romantic relationships, and bond with her nephew, André Palasse. Featuring exclusive access to Chanel’s private collection of fashion, jewelry, and art, the book reveals rare personal artifacts and uncovers her secretive World War II activities. Divided into five sections, it offers a deeper understanding of the complex woman behind the iconic brand, making it a must-read for fashion enthusiasts.
